Police are looking for two men in relation to a stabbing outside of a Granville Street nightclub.

On January 9th around 3 a.m., a  22-year-old North Vancouver man was stabbed during a fight with a group of men outside the Cabana Nightclub at 1159 Granville Street. He was taken to hospital with serious injuries.

The men fled, one of whom was located by police nearby. He was released a short time later.

Investigators want to speak to two other men, who are believed to have been involved in the fight.

The first was described as a light-skinned man in his 20s with long black hair. He was wearing a white jacket and black pants.

The second was described as a South Asian man, 25-years-old with a medium build. He was wearing a dark baseball hat with a white logo on the front, a black jacket, black pants, and black runners.
